Fallen Officer Toy Drive 2019

‘Tis the Season of Giving! Thanks to everyone who donated new, unwrapped toys to the families of our fallen deputies nationwide. Sheriff Ric Bradshaw and the PBSO Motors Unit participated in The Annual Fallen Officer Toy Drive & BBQ. The Sheriff wants the kids of our Fallen Deputies to know that we care about them.

National Runaway Prevention Month

To our young ones feeling down, discouraged or helpless, please know: You are loved! You are our pride and joy! You are our future. If you don’t feel safe at home, let’s have a talk, reach out to us or someone in school who can help. This month is National Runaway Prevention Month and we want to make sure our kids feel safe at home. If you feel like running away or need a safe place to go, call 1-800-RUNAWAY (1-800-786-2929)...

Boys & Girls Club Visit

We placed a visit to the Marjorie Fisher Boys & Girls Club. Through conversation, the teens learned that some of our deputies grew up going to the Boys & Girls Club too. We had such a great time, they asked us to come by more often to spend time with the teens.
